Factory directly supply Anionic Polyacrylamide Polymer - Azobisisobutyronitrile with no side effects – IDE
Azobisisobutyronitrile, AIBN for short, chemical formula is C8H12N4, soluble in organic solvents such as methanol, ethanol, ether, acetone, petroleum ether and aniline. When heated, it will release nitrogen and organic cyanide containing -(CH2)2-C-CN group. It decomposes slowly at room temperature and rapidly decomposes at 100°C.
